Output d715754fd46b70ba7fecffdcf09d45a4d0e5f2deefd48955e2fe62b4bcf2897d:1

value
681825537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d11bcf6a7aedc46d90b291654f7121fcb1da7da OP_EQUAL
address
3MqvWQVDitu3aEd6mA1L9xZ6Vfnpt8G13o
transaction
d715754fd46b70ba7fecffdcf09d45a4d0e5f2deefd48955e2fe62b4bcf2897d
confirmations
382412
spent
true